Paintings stolen in three-minute Italian heist

Three paintings worth millions of euros were stolen in just three minutes from the Magnani-Rocca Foundation in northern Italy.

Four men broke into the museum’s main entrance on the night of March 22nd.

The museum said the thieves appeared "structured and organised" and it seemed like they wanted to steal more if the alarm had not gone off.

The paintings by the French artists Renoir, Cézanne and Matisse are estimated to be worth around €9 million.

It’s one of the most significant art thefts in Italy in years.
